Summer School: Intensive German Course

Topic: The intensive German courses at Leuphana University combine language training with intercultural exchange. International participants improve their German language skills in compact lessons and experience a varied leisure programme at the same time. Joint activities and excursions promote cultural understanding and enable the development of an international network in an inspiring environment.

Target group: students from partner universities

Time period: 

  • 3 - 24 September 2025
    OR
  • 9 - 31 March 2026

Location: Leuphana Campus, Lüneburg, Germany

Costs: € 450.00

Summer School: Feature your Future

Topic: The Spring School 2025 is a three-day online event designed for advanced Master’s students and doctoral candidates from KU Leuven and Leuphana university (host). The event focuses on future research culture under the theme "Envisioning Research Culture in 2050." Through professional workshops and lectures, participants will develop scenarios for research culture by applying predictive methods such as strategic foresight and scenario development. The program encourages participants to explore and shape the future of research, improving both their understanding of potential developments and their career prospects in academia and beyond.

Target group: Advanced Master's students and doctoral candidates

Time period: 19 February 2025 (kick-off), 2.-4. April 2025 (main event)

Location: Zoom

Costs: -

Application deadline: 1 December 2024

Summer School: How many Roads...?

Topic: The Leuphana Summer School "How many Roads...?" focusses on diverse life paths and decision-making processes, especially for female and non-binary academics in the qualification phase. It offers workshops and other exchange formats that support participants in reflecting on their own professional and personal goals, developing interdisciplinary skills and networking.

Target group: female and non-binary doctoral students and postdocs
